A fractionation of the membrane extract of rat testes revealed the existence of pp60(c-src) kinase activity. The expression of pp60(c-src) was examined in the developing rat testes. The immunecomplex kinase assay using a monoclonal antibody specific to pp60(c-src)(mAb327) showed that the expression of pp60(c-src) kinase activity increased during the development of rat testes and declined in the adult. The increase in pp60(c-src) kinase activity observed during the development of rat testes was accompanied with an increase in the amount of pp60(c-src) protein. The peak period in the increase of pp60(c-src) kinase activity well coincided with the timing, when the spermatogenesis by meiosis just began. The immunohistochemical staining of pp60(c-src) in rat testes demonstrated that pp60(c-src) is most abundantly expressed in the spermatids which are the spermatogenic cells in the post-meiotic phase of the spermatogenesis. These findings strongly suggest that pp60(c-src) is a developmentally regulated gene product which is involved in rat spermatogenesis. (C) 1995 Academic Press, Inc.
